Why we raise Cotswolds .Why we raise Cotswold sheep… Preserving and conserving a unique and valuable breed. Ewes are great mothers, few birthing problems Polled breed, with ewes weighing up to 200 pounds and rams 300 pounds. They are a very friendly sheep and there is definitely a queenly quality about the ewes Cotswolds are easy to raise and do well on coarser feeds and are excellent foragers and can thrive in harsh climates, even with a lot of rainfall.
